Къде се съхранява redux?
Къде се съхранява redux?

Видео: Къде се съхранява redux?

Видео: Къде се съхранява redux?
Видео: Този нов вид Зомби Имат Интелект, те се Раждат Заразени (Кратък Преразказ) 2024, Ноември
Anonim

Държавата в Redux е съхранени в памет. Това означава, че ако обновите страницата, състоянието се изтрива. Държавата в redux е просто променлива, която се запазва в паметта, защото се позовава от всички redux функции.

По същия начин, как да проверя моя магазин Redux?

Достъп Магазин Redux Във вашите DevTools превключете към контекста „Вашето приложение“, като използвате падащото меню (подчертано на изображението по-долу) и трябва да можете да стигнете до Магазин Redux и вижте тока му състояние . Ако успеем да стигнем до магазин от конзолата на DevTools - можем да стигнем до нея от нашия Cypress тест.

Впоследствие въпросът е дали Redux използва локално съхранение? Запазване в LocalStorage е постигнати с помощта на Redux междинен софтуер и записва всеки път, когато действие е се обработва от вашия редуктор. Вие ще трябва да прехвърлите метода за запис Redux's applyMiddleware метод, така

Оттук нататък какво е магазин в Redux?

Redux е контейнер за състояние за JavaScript приложения, често наричан a Магазин Redux . То магазини цялото състояние на приложението в дърво с неизменни обекти. За да създадете a магазин функцията createStore(reducer, [initialState], [enhancer]) се използва за създаване на нов магазин . Необходими са три аргумента: редуктор - функция за намаляване.

Сигурен ли е магазинът Redux?

1 отговор. Redux съхранява на състояние в обект на JavaScript. Това го прави уязвим за XSS атака точно като localStorage или sessionStorage. Ако искате вашият JWT да бъде четим от страна на клиента, можете да използвате свободно Redux , просто се уверете, че се грижите правилно за XSS.

Препоръчано: